[Atlanta, GA] February 13, 2024 — Strategic Treasurer and Allspring Global Investments recently released the Liquidity Risk Survey Results Report. This survey’s questions probed 160 treasury and finance professionals on key aspects of their liquidity risk management. Details were gathered about the respondents’ views, practices, drivers, challenges, and plans surrounding liquidity risk.

All excellent companies are intentional in optimizing working capital. Technology can be an important tool in working capital initiatives, whether through driving up efficiency in the cash conversion cycle (CCC) or by offering supply chain finance (SCF). This webinar will cover SCF and CCC automation solutions, explaining what they do, the factors driving their adoption, different SCF models, and the leading practices for implementing these types of solutions. This includes a discussion of working capital councils, eliminating competing KPIs, and improving supplier participation.
